70 % isopropyl alcohol does the trick. The building boards plank supports will not stay square to the building board, so I will add blocks to the board to hold them square. This is one of the problems I had aligning the planks on my first attempt as they kept moving.

Started the rebuild after ungluing what I had already done, and messed up. I was surprised at the success using 70% isopropyl alcohol to remove the planking. The bottom p[anks here are already glued in place with the keel plank over them. I am wetting the garboard planks and sanding them, they fit very well on the test fit, but need a little more wetting prior to gluing. The stern section kept rising up, so I glued a popsicle stick at the end of the mother board and that secured the stern, no more moving and rising.

Soaking is almost always needed, the hair curler or soldering iron, plank bender use the water to generate steam inside to soften fibers and allow planks to bend.

The secret is to use form to help form bend off ship, and then dry with heat source. Other way is to soak and clip to ship and clamp in place and allow to air dry.
 
Best to shape or form to fit wet, then allow to dry before you try to glue. When dried in place, they hold the shape when being glued much better.

Heating with steam and then using heat to dry in place is quicker and can be done on the spot, for faster work, depends if you have equipment or time to spare.
